在 2021/12/8 13:27, Kees Cook 写道: > On Wed, Dec 08, 2021 at 11:04:49AM +0800, Xiu Jianfeng wrote: >> Xiu Jianfeng (2): >> string.h: Introduce memset_range() for wiping members > For doing a memset range, the preferred method is to use > a struct_group in the structure itself. This makes the range > self-documenting, and allows the compile to validate the exact size, > makes it addressable, etc. The other memset helpers are for "everything > to the end", which doesn't usually benefit from the struct_group style > of range declaration. Do you mean there is no need to introduce this helper, but to use struct_group in the struct directly? > >> bpf: use memset_range helper in __mark_reg_known > I never saw this patch arrive on the list?
